AR Husker Fan Posted November 5, 2009 Share Posted November 5, 2009 There are options, but each has drawbacks. As HSKRNOKC noted, moderation is one option - a user's posts (including new topics) go into a queue until approved. A second is to create a new member rank or group. We can set that designation so that a person can't post - but that is an all or nothing proposition. Similar to a ban. The third option is to suspend posting privilges for a set time. So, if someone is cluttering the board, we can set their account so that can't post for X number of hours, days, weeks, etc. There's nothing that allows us to deny posting based on count or time, and that's something we wouldn't want to do; is someone is a lurker and finally decides to start posting, we don't really want to inhibit that - by lurking they may have adapted to the Board's culture.
